About Saharpur Village
Saharpur is a village in Narayanpur tehsil in district of Jamtara, Jharkhand, India. As per the data provided by Census of India in 2011, total population of Saharpur was 2,590 which includes 1,327 males and 1,263 females. Saharpur covers 319 ha area. Pincode of Saharpur is 815352.
